Course Contents:
This course is aimed at students who have attended the lecture Cryptocurrencies and want to understand and examine some aspects of this topic in more detail. It provides a platform to check novel applications based on Blockchain technology for their feasibility and usefulness.
Complex cryptographic systems and ideas from the lecture Cryptocurrencies should be understood in team work and implemented in a decentralized system. The students are asked to develop a project plan and outline, which should be implemented over the course of the semester.
The students get first experiences with the implementation of a more complex development project.
Preconditions:
This course is directed at students that finished the cryptocurrencies lecture with good marks and programming skills.
